Ingredients and spices that need to be Take to make Banana cake:

  1. 2 cups flour
  2. 1 tsp baking soda
  3. 1 tbsp ground cinnamon
  4. 1/4 tsp salt
  5. 2 eggs
  6. 1 cup vegetable oil
  7. 3/4 cup brown sugar
  8. 1 cup mashed bananas

Steps to make to make Banana cake

  1. Mix flour, baking soda, cinnamon & salt in large bowl.
  2. Mix oil & sugar, stir in beaten eggs and mashed bananas
  3. Make a well in flour mixture and pour banana mixture, mix just to moisten
  4. Pour into greased 7"by 7" baking pan. Sprinkle oats or poppy seeds on top. Bake for 50-60 mins at 180 degrees (insert toothpick and check if it comes out clean)
  5. Remove from oven allow cake to cool in pan for 10 minutes
  6. Turn your cake on rack and cool for 45-60 minutes
